Lady Anne Blunt's A Pilgrimage to Nejd: The Court of Arab Emir & Persian Campaign is a remarkable account of her travels to the Arabian Peninsula in the late 19th century. Blunt's literary style is both descriptive and introspective, providing readers with vivid images of the landscapes and cultures she encounters. The book offers a unique perspective on the Arabian region during a time of great political and social change, making it a valuable historical and anthropological text. Lady Anne Blunt, a British aristocrat and accomplished equestrian, was known for her love of horses and her interest in the Middle East. Her travels to Nejd were motivated by a desire to explore the Arabian culture and history, as well as to further her own intellectual pursuits. Blunt's keen observations and deep understanding of the region shine through in her writing, making A Pilgrimage to Nejd a must-read for anyone interested in Middle Eastern studies.
